Strategic Profile
Mengniu holds approximately 22% market share in China's dairy market, positioning it as the second-largest player after Yili Group with 25%. The company has a significant competitive moat characterized by strong brand presence, extensive distribution network in China, and continuous investment in R&D to bring innovative products to market.

Top Insights
70% of revenue comes from dairy products, 15% from ice cream, 10% from baby food, and 5% from other products
Market share of 22% makes Mengniu the second-largest dairy company in China after Yili Group
Company executed $3.55 million share buyback to bolster investor confidence amid market volatility
Iniciating sustainable sourcing through certified soybean shipments from Brazil for eco-friendly dairy production through 2030
Named Competitors
Yili Group — Market leader with 25% dairy market share in China
Bright Dairy & Food — Major competitor with 10% market share
Wondersun Dairy — Regional competitor with 6% market share
